Deposes

/dɪˈpoʊzɪz/

Definitions

  1. (v.) Third-person singular present tense of depose.
    She deposes witnesses during the trial preparation.

Forms

  • depose
  • deposed
  • deposing

Commentary

As a verb form, 'deposes' is used in legal contexts to indicate a witness giving sworn testimony in the present tense.
